810XL Introduction and Features

Congratulations on purchasing the 810XL bass enclosure by Hartke! The XL Series enclosures have been designed to provide excellent tone with a fast attack, deep low-end and punchy output. The 810XL Features eight 10", proprietary low frequency drivers with specially designed aluminum cones, large voice coils on Kapton formers, impregnated fabric surrounds, and matched convex dust covers all mounted in a heavy-duty steel frames. In order to reduce distortion caused by standing waves, and to increase the overall output level, the 810XL enclosure has been designed with four separate chambers, each housing two 10" drivers. Using heavy-duty plywood construction, covered in rugged carpet with recessed jack plate and ergonomic metal handles, the 810XL will provide reliable performance from gig to gig and venue to venue.

Connecting the 810XL

About Impedance

Before you hook up your speaker cabinet, be sure that you understand a little about impedance. Impedance is the electronic load that the speaker puts on the power amplifier and is measured in Ohms.

Here is the tricky, yet simple rule of impedance: When two speakers are wired in "Parallel" the total impedance is cut in half and when two speakers are wire in "Series" the total impedance is the sum of the speakers individual impedance.

The 810XL impedance is 4 Ohms. So, when two 810XL's are connected together in parallel, the total impedance is 2 Ohms. The impedance of your speaker also has an effect on your amplifier. In general, the lower the impedance, the more power your amplifier will put out.

IMPORTANT: There is a minimum safe impedance so be sure to check the manufacturer's recommended impedance for your amplifier to avoid any damage to your amplifier or voiding your warranty.

Connecting the 810XL to Your Amplifier

The 810XL connections are made via 1/4" phone jack located on the rear panel jack-plate. Be sure to make your connection with un-shielded speaker cable. Connect the Amplifier Output to the speaker Input on the 810XL's rear jackplate.

Specifications

Hartke 810XL Specifications

Type Tuned, Sealed Enclosure

Impedance

4

Ohms

Power Handling 800 Watts RMS Power Handling

Drivers 8 - Hartke 10XL8 Special Design

Aluminum 10", 8 ohm, 100 watt drive units

SPL 100dB @ 1W/1M

Frequency Response 40Hz - 5kHz

Input 1/4" Phone jack

Weight 145 lbs. (65.77 kg)

Dimensions Height:48" (121.92 cm)

Width: 24" (60.96 cm)

Depth: 16" (40.64 cm)
